Abstract

We show that geometrical scaling exhibited by the spectra measured by the CMS collaboration at the LHC is substantially improved if the exponent of the saturation scale depends on . This dependence is shown to be the same as the dependence of small exponent of structure function in deep inelastic scattering taken at the scale
